<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0//EN" "http://www.w3.org/TR/REC-html40/strict.dtd">
<html><head><meta name="qrichtext" content="1" /><style type="text/css">
p, li { white-space: pre-wrap; }
</style></head><body style=" font-family:'Exo 2'; font-size:8pt; font-weight:400; font-style:normal;">
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Ah, a big miss on my behalf, I apologize. So what should I be looking at ?</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">The packet stream looks consistent, but then again I’ve no idea how to figure out what’s going on in order to debug this...</p>
<p style="-qt-paragraph-type:empty; marg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; ">&nbsp;</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Thanks,</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">-- </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><span style=" font-weight:600;">Iskren Hadzhinedev</span></p>
<p style="-qt-paragraph-type:empty; marg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; ">&nbsp;</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br />On Friday 17 October 2014 10:43:13 Guillermo Ruiz Camauer wrote:<br /></p>
<p style=" margin-top:12px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">See here:  <a href="http://sokratisg.net/2012/04/01/udp-tcp-checksum-errors-from-tcpdump-nic-hardware-offloading/"><span style=" text-decoration: underline; color:#0057ae;">http://sokratisg.net/2012/04/01/udp-tcp-checksum-errors-from-tcpdump-nic-hardware-offloading/</span></a></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">On Fri, Oct 17, 2014 at 9:49 AM, Iskren Hadzhinedev &lt;<a href="mailto:iskren.hadzhinedev@ikiji.com"><span style=" text-decoration: underline; color:#0057ae;">iskren.hadzhinedev@ikiji.com</span></a>&gt; wrote:<br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Hello,</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Apologies for the late reply.</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">I don’t think there’s any transcoding, as the endpoint negotiation is set to “generous” and examining the SDPs shows that both endpoints negotiate on PCMA/PCMU. I got a pcap of the RTP streams with tcpdump and I see that from the 126500 packets, 62964 are marked with “bad udp cksum”. All packets with bad udp checksum are originating from the FreeSWITCH box. Is this information helpful at all and what else can I do to figure out the reason behind these issues? Thank you!</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Kind regards,</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">-- </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><span style=" font-weight:600;">Iskren Hadzhinedev</span></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br />On Tuesday 14 October 2014 10:03:32 Michael Jerris wrote:<br /></p>
<p style=" margin-top:12px; margin-bottom:12px; margin-left:86px; margin-right:80px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">is there even any transcoding involved in your scenario?  Are the artifacts present in the inbound stream as well.  I would get a tcpdump and analyze the inbound and outbound streams to see a bit more detail of what is going on.</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:86px; margin-right:80px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:86px; margin-right:80px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Mike</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:86px; margin-right:80px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:86px; margin-right:80px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">On Oct 14, 2014, at 5:12 AM, Iskren Hadzhinedev &lt;<a href="mailto:iskren.hadzhinedev@ikiji.com"><span style=" text-decoration: underline; color:#0057ae;">iskren.hadzhinedev@ikiji.com</span></a>&gt; wrote:</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:12px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Hi everyone,</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Some of the calls using PCMA/PCMU have artifacts (distorted sound, “robotic” voice, stutter) on what looks like a random basis. The other codecs I have tried don’t have issues (tried GSM, iLBC,G722, G729, SILK). Apart from FreeSWITCH, the only other thing running on the machine is a static webpage served by nginx and the load is almost always at 0. Any help or advise on how to chase down this issue is highly appreciated!</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">System specs:</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Machine: Xen VM</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">RAM: 1GB</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">CPU: Dualcore 2.4 Ghz 64bit</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">OS: CentOS 6.5</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">FreeSWITCH Version: 1.5.13b+git~20140621T003222Z~47891d5caa~64bit</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Max # simultaneous calls: 12</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Calls per second: at most 3</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"> </p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Endpoints used for testing:</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Hardware phones: Yealink T42G, Yealink T48G, Gigaset DE900, Cisco 7975 (with SIP firmware)</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Softphones: CounterPath Bria for Android, CsipSimple (android), Linphone, Jitsi</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:126px; margin-right:120px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">Mobile provider and a landline via gateway.</p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:46px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br />_________________________________________________________________________<br />Professional FreeSWITCH Consulting Services:<br /><a href="mailto:consulting@freeswitch.org"><span style=" text-decoration: underline; color:#0057ae;">consulting@freeswitch.org</span></a><br /><a href="http://www.freeswitchsolutions.com"><span style=" text-decoration: underline; color:#0057ae;">http://www.freeswitchsolutions.com</span></a><br /><br />Official FreeSWITCH Sites<br /><a href="http://www.freeswitch.org"><span style=" text-decoration: underline; color:#0057ae;">http://www.freeswitch.org</span></a><br /><a href="http://confluence.freeswitch.org"><span style=" text-decoration: underline; color:#0057ae;">http://confluence.freeswitch.org</span></a><br /><a href="http://www.cluecon.com"><span style=" text-decoration: underline; color:#0057ae;">http://www.cluecon.com</span></a><br /><br />FreeSWITCH-powered IP PBX: The CudaTel Communication Server<br /><a href="http://www.cudatel.com"><span style=" text-decoration: underline; color:#0057ae;">http://www.cudatel.com</span></a><br /><br />FreeSWITCH-users mailing list<br /><a href="mailto:FreeSWITCH-users@lists.freeswitch.org"><span style=" text-decoration: underline; color:#0057ae;">FreeSWITCH-users@lists.freeswitch.org</span></a><br /><a href="http://lists.freeswitch.org/mailman/listinfo/freeswitch-users"><span style=" text-decoration: underline; color:#0057ae;">http://lists.freeswitch.org/mailman/listinfo/freeswitch-users</span></a><br />UNSUBSCRIBE:<a href="http://lists.freeswitch.org/mailman/options/freeswitch-users"><span style=" text-decoration: underline; color:#0057ae;">http://lists.freeswitch.org/mailman/options/freeswitch-users</span></a><br /><a href="http://www.freeswitch.org"><span style=" text-decoration: underline; color:#0057ae;">http://www.freeswitch.org</span></a><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:40px; margin-right:40px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;">-- <br />Guillermo Ruiz Camauer<br /></p>
<p style=" margin-top:0px; margin-bottom:0px; margin-left:0px; margin-right:0px; -qt-block-indent:0; text-indent:0px; -qt-user-state:0;"><br /><br /></p></body></html>